Generative AI and Academic Integrity in Online Distance Learning: The AI-Aware Assessment Policy Index for the Global South

2025-09-30

Abstract excerpt

<h4>Background: </h4> Generative artificial intelligence (AI) is transforming assessment and academic-integrity practice, yet most online and distance-learning (ODL) universities in the Global South must navigate this disruption with limited resources and acute equity concerns. <h4>Purpose:</h4> Guided by sociotechnical-systems theory, neo-institutional isomorphism, and value-sensitive design, the study synthesise...
